## Changelog — Font vendoring defaults changed

As of this release, the Bracken UI build no longer fetches third-party fonts at build time. All typefaces used by the Lanternwell suite are now vendored into the repo under a dedicated assets directory, and the fetch step is skipped by default. If you're onboarding, nothing to install — the fonts travel with the checkout. The build flags controlling this behavior are listed below.

settings of hadup-yafog:
LAMAEL_PIN=3761
LAMAEL_TENANT=istmir
LAMAEL_METRICS_HOST=metrics.lamael.plorvasys.test
LAMAEL_SEAL=seal_8ea68500
LAMAEL_STANDBY_TEAM=fraok

## Who to Ping: Markdown Pipeline (Inkhollow)

Reviewing a change to the Inkhollow markdown rendering pipeline? The sanitizer and extension registry are owned by the Docs Infra crew — don't approve parser changes without their thumbs-up. Snapshot tests live in `render/fixtures`; regenerate them, don't hand-edit. For anything gnarly, reach Docs Infra at the address below.

alerts address for kajog-tadup: druox@plorvanet.internal

# Loading Dock Access — Thornfield Works

Deliveries to the Thornfield Works loading dock are accepted Monday to Friday, 07:00–15:30 only. Contractors must report to the dock office on arrival, wear hi-vis at all times, and keep the roller shutter clear. Out-of-hours deliveries require written approval from Facilities. To open the dock's pedestrian side door, enter the code below.

staff pass of kawip-hawef = bdg-QLP-2